Web26 sep. 2024 · Clean The Pipes. Use either bleach or a mixture of hot water/white vinegar to clean the washbasin and the drainage pipes. Mix up 50/50 water and white vinegar. Heat the mixture until it is too hot to touch and pour it into the basin. This will kill any fruit flies inside the pipes and any eggs they might have laid. Web3 mrt. 2024 · Catch fruit flies in a bowl filled with apple cider vinegar and a few drops of dish soap.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ap so flies can get in but not escape. Roll a piece of paper into a cone and stick it inside of a glass jar with ripe fruit. Empty the trap and replace the bait every 2–3 days to get rid of the flies.

Web30 mrt. 2024 · To make a homemade fruit fly spray, pour 1 cup of warm water into a hand spray bottle, then add 5 teaspoons of peppermint oil. Spray the solution directly on the fruit flies to repel them.
